Application & Simulation Requirement

Antennas are virtually everywhere such as radio, WIFI, cell networks, and satellite links as well as sensor systems such as radar, guidance and collision avoidance all rely on antennas to function.

The correct placement of antennas can make or break a system when installed on a vehicle, aircraft, ship or structure. Electromagnetic simulation of antenna design and its interaction with the entire system allows designers to evaluate “what if” real life scenarios.

    Antenna Simulation Technologies in HFSS

    Ansys HFSS is a valuable tool which offers the full suite of simulation tools and technologies for antenna design and placement simulation. Based on the problem need to be solved, these antenna simulation methods and tools can be used.

    Key features in HFSS Technology for antenna design and Placement are:
  • HFSS Finite Element Method (FEM)
  • HFSS Integral-Equation (IE)
  • HFSS Asymptotic
  • HFSS Physical Optics (PO)
  • HFSS Transient
